I use 2 Marins a San Rafael for everyday commute which has 35mm tyres and front suspension. Fast enough on the road and works well on the short unmade path I have to go down. The other is a Fairfax with Carbon forks and 28mm tyres Although I have used this for the commute once it is not so nice on the unmade path, nothing to do with the tyres but the stiffer faster frame and forks makes it a bit harsh. I suppose if I had never had the San Rafael the Fairfax would be fine. So what I am saying is 28mm and 35mm tyres work Ok on tow paths etc. I have taken the 35mm on local bridalways in the summer/dry which was also fine.
